The British Graham Land Expedition was a 1934–1937 British Antarctic exploration mission led by John Rymill that conducted extensive surveying and mapping of the Antarctic Peninsula region.

  • A. Byrd Antarctic Expedition I
    Byrd Antarctic Expedition I was a pioneering late-1920s American scientific and exploratory mission to Antarctica led by aviator and polar explorer Richard E. Byrd, notable for its extensive use of aircraft and radio.
  • B. French Antarctic Expedition
    The French Antarctic Expedition was a series of early 20th-century French-led scientific and exploratory voyages to Antarctica, notably under explorer Jean-Baptiste Charcot, which contributed significantly to the mapping and study of the continent.
  • C. Shackleton–Rowett Expedition
    The Shackleton–Rowett Expedition was Sir Ernest Shackleton’s final Antarctic voyage (1921–1922), a largely scientific and exploratory mission that ended with his death in South Georgia.
  • D. Russian Antarctic Expedition
    The Russian Antarctic Expedition is Russia’s national polar research program responsible for conducting scientific exploration and maintaining research stations across Antarctica.
  • E. US Antarctic Service Expedition
    The US Antarctic Service Expedition was a 1939–1941 American government-sponsored mission led by Richard E. Byrd to explore and conduct scientific research in Antarctica.
